70mm Adjustable Levelling Foot – M16 x 150mm Thread This 70mm Adjustable Levelling Foot with an M16 x 150mm thread is engineered for precise height adjustments in various industrial applications. Its robust design ensures stability on uneven surfaces, making it ideal for machinery, shelving, and equipment requiring reliable support. With a static load capacity of 1500kg, this levelling foot is a vital component for enhancing operational efficiency. Technical Specifications Specification Value Colour Black Static Load (kg) 1500 Thread Finish Zinc Plated Adjustable Foot Height (H) (mm) 186 Applications This adjustable levelling foot is commonly utilized in: Machinery: For levelling and stabilising industrial machines. Shelving: Ensuring stable support for shelving units. Equipment: Providing adjustable support for various equipment setups. Frequently Asked Questions What is the load capacity of this levelling foot? The static load capacity is 1500kg, making it suitable for heavy-duty applications. Can this levelling foot be used on uneven surfaces? Yes, its tilting feature allows it to maintain stability on uneven surfaces. What is the thread size of this adjustable foot? It features an M16 thread size, ensuring compatibility with corresponding fittings. Is the thread finish resistant to corrosion? Yes, the zinc-plated finish provides excellent resistance to corrosion. What is the diameter of the base? The base diameter is 70mm, providing a stable footing for various applications. How much height adjustment does it allow? The thread length of 150mm allows for significant height adjustment.
